How Can Consumers Stay Informed About FDA Recalls?

Staying updated on food recalls is crucial for maintaining health and safety. The FDA offers various resources that consumers can utilize to keep track of food safety announcements. Some of these resources include:

  • The FDA’s official website, which lists all current food recalls.
  • Social media channels where the FDA shares timely updates.
  • Sign up for email alerts to receive notifications about recalls.

What Should You Do if You Have the Affected Ramen?

If you find that you have purchased ramen that has been recalled, it is essential to take immediate action. The steps include:

  1. Check the packaging for the product code and expiration date.
  2. Follow the instructions provided in the recall notice.
  3. Return the product to the retailer for a refund or dispose of it properly.
